The name Aidil generally conveys the idea of a festive or celebratory spirit. It's often associated with happiness and joy, as it's derived from Arabic, connecting to Muslim celebrations like Eid. While meanings can vary slightly, the essence of celebration and cherishing moments is prevalent in the name's implications, making it a name symbolizing warmth and togetherness.
Pronounced like 'eye-deal', with stress on the first syllable.
Origin of Aidil
The name Aidil has its roots in Arabic culture. It is often linked with Islamic festivals and celebrations, evident in the resemblance to "Eid," the Muslim holiday. The name symbolizes a spirit of joy and community as observed in Muslim cultural traditions. Over time, Aidil has found its presence in regions with significant Muslim populations.

Global Distribution and Gender Ratio of the Name Aidil
Country
Usage %
Female %
Male %
Malaysia
66.44%
4.14%
95.86%
Indonesia
21.88%
0%
100%
Singapore
6.99%
0%
100%
Brazil
1.15%
80%
20%
United States
0.92%
25%
75%
The analysis of gender and popularity by country is derived from data sourced from Gender API.
